BTW, always remove and discard the plastic valve cap. In the event of a "roll off" of the tire from the rim, you have a greater chance of the tire coming free of the rim and a better chance of avoiding a fall.

Keeping the cap on the valve stem will result in zero chance of the valve stem slipping free thru the rim hole. The tire remains attached to the rim and causes the rotating wheel to stop instantly when it entangles with the fork or stays. Over you go.
